I just discovered Google makes a product called Sketchup that makes 3D modelling pretty damn easy for everyone. While not a full CAD program, probably decent enough for basic parts design, etc.

What do you think of creating a section for design models where members can post their parts designs for others to leverage. I realize some want to keep their designs private, but I think there would be enough people interested in sharing.

Consider the swan neck design for the 944 brake cable end. How much better would it be if you could pull a 3D model with measurements than looking at the photocopied image we have up there now?

Sketchup has a free version that seems functional enough. The licensed version is $495 however. You can find it at sketchup.google.com.
